So, lets break down the how to’s for those of us who are new to planking –

  1. Lie face down on mat resting on the floor, palms down flat on the floor.
  2. Push up off the floor resting on your elbows (you can push up with arms straight if you prefer). Legs out straight behind you.
  3. Keep your back flat with neutral spine (a straight line from head to heels).
  4. Brace/contract your abdominals make sure you don’t stick your butt up in the air or have your body sagging in the middle.
